A regional construction firm in Bissoe is seeking a motivated Sales Administrator & Front of House to ensure smooth sales operations and deliver a welcoming experience for clients.

Responsibilities include:

  • Managing incoming communications
  • Processing sales orders
  • Assisting with customer inquiries

The ideal candidate will possess strong communication and organisational skills, with previous experience preferred. This position offers a dynamic work environment and opportunities for professional growth along with a competitive salary and benefits package.

How to prepare for a job interview at Cornish Concrete Products Ltd

✨Know the Company Inside Out

Before your interview, do some homework on the regional construction firm. Understand their projects, values, and what sets them apart in the industry. This will not only impress the interviewer but also help you tailor your answers to align with their goals.

✨Showcase Your Communication Skills

As a Sales Administrator & Front of House, strong communication is key. Prepare examples from your past experiences where you effectively managed client communications or resolved inquiries. Practising clear and concise responses will demonstrate your ability to handle the role's responsibilities.

✨Organisational Skills are a Must

Be ready to discuss how you stay organised in a busy environment. Share specific tools or methods you use to manage tasks and prioritise effectively. This will show that you can handle the dynamic nature of the job and keep sales operations running smoothly.

✨Ask Insightful Questions

At the end of the interview, don’t forget to ask questions! Inquire about the team dynamics, growth opportunities, or how success is measured in the role. This shows your genuine interest in the position and helps you assess if it’s the right fit for you.
